Explain Window manager

Window manager: This is a window manager which provides a computer user with a virtual desktop having one or more windows and working regions in which individual programs might be run. Window managers permit the contents of a user's desktop to be arranged as needed via resizing and arranging windows, and give for drag-and-drop operations in collaboration with the operating system. They as well monitor the mouse movements to pop-up menus, for illustration.
